You're talking to the person who has over 600 hours of playtime in this game on Steam all because on there the 100% requires beating nightmare boss rush with all versions of all characters.  Eventually I did pull it off.  It took a ton of practice because I'm just not as good with every character who isn't Hugo.  Be glad this version only requires beating it once with any character instead of all because I doubt I would have tried for the plats if it did.

 

Try doing nightmare boss rush with EX Hugo.  EX version of Hugo has a bit more range and having to go from EX to regular on the Steam version for the nightmare boss rush, I can tell you there is a huge difference.  EX Hugo was also the first character I was able to pull it off with.  It will take patience and persistence, but it is a very doable thing.  This is a game where skill can be gained through practice because it's a matter of learning how to dodge the attacks.  Expect it to take more than a few tries the first time, but I can attest to the fact that even a terrible player like myself was capable of learning how to pull it off.  The final boss is definitely tricky and even sometimes takes me a few tries to do it, but once you know the patterns it's very doable.
